The sixth annual Rock & Rescue event is set for 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. Saturday at the Guthrie Green park, 111 E. Brady St.
The free event is hosted by the Oklahoma Alliance for Animals. Attendees are invited to bring their own pets or adopt a pet from one of the dozen of area rescue groups that will be at the event.
Music, food and vendors will be part of the event. Representatives from local pet-related businesses -- including vets, trainers, retailers, groomers and doggie day cares -- will be on hand to talk with pet owners. Microchipping will be available for $25.
The event will also feature pet contests, including a bikini contest at 11 a.m., a "best rocker" concert at noon and a best tricks contest at 1 p.m.
